George bought 7.5 cases of pancake mix for his diner. A case contains 12 1.3-pound boxes. How many pounds of pancake mix did Geo

rge buy?

Answer:

117 pounds

Step-by-step explanation:

We have been given that a case contains 12 1.3-pound boxes.

The number of pounds in one case would be 12 times 1.3 pounds.

\text{The number of pounds in one case}=12\times 1.4\text{ pounds}

\text{The number of pounds in one case}=15.6\text{ pounds}

To find number of pounds in 7.5 cases, we will multiply number of pounds in one case by 7.5.

\text{The number of pounds in 7.5 cases}=7.5\times 15.6\text{ pounds}

\text{The number of pounds in 7.5 cases}=117\text{ pounds}

Therefore, George bought 117 pounds of pancake mix.

Jackson picked apples for his family. He picked a total of 8 1/4 pounds. He took 3 3/4 pounds to his aunt and 2 3/8 to his mothe
GalinKa [24]

Answer: 2 1/8 pounds of apples were left to give his grandmother.

Step-by-step explanation:

He picked a total of 8 1/4 pounds. Converting 8 1/4 pounds to improper fraction, it becomes 33/4 pounds.

He took 3 3/4 pounds to his aunt. Converting 3 3/4 pounds to improper fraction, it becomes 15/4 pounds.

He also took 2 3/8 to his mother. Converting 2 3/8 pounds to improper fraction, it becomes 19/8 pounds.

The total number of apples that he gave to his aunt and mother is

15/4 + 19/8 = 49/8 pounds

The number of pounds of apples left to give his grandmother is

33/4 - 49/8 = 17/8 = 2 1/8 pounds

Help Solve Domain and Range
Zielflug [23.3K]

You would likely benefit far more from learning the definitions of "domain" and "range" than from being given the domain and range in each of these cases.

The domain of a function includes all values of the independent variable for which the function is defined (that is, for which there is a graph). In Case 1, x can have any real value, and so the domain is (-infinity, infinity).

The range of a function includes all values that the dependent value can have (that is, for which there is a graph). In Case 1, y can take on any real value, and so the range is (-infinity, infinity).


Contrast this case to Case 2. Here, y has only ONE value, so the range is simply y=2, or {2}. x can take on any value, so the domain is (-infinity, infinity).
